How much does it cost to rent a home in San Carlos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| San Carlos Park 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,710 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
| San Carlos Park 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,727 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
| San Carlos Park 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,943 | $1,745 | $10,000+ |
| San Carlos Park 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$10,243 | $6,500 | $10,000+ |
| San Carlos Park 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,000 | $3,000 | $3,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about San Carlos Park
What type of rentals are currently available in San Carlos Park?
There are currently 74 Apartments for Rent in San Carlos Park, FL with pricing that ranges from $149 to $7,069. There are also 247 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in San Carlos Park ranging from $1,000 to $18,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in San Carlos Park?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in San Carlos Park ranges from $1,000 to $18,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,232.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in San Carlos Park?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in San Carlos Park range from $1,550 to $5,096,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,500 to $18,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,745 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$745.
